Adblock Test: Check Your AdBlocker for Maximum Privacy and Security
Adblock test представляет собой проверку наличия блокировщика рекламы на сайте или в браузере. Это может быть полезно для веб-разработчиков и владельцев сайтов для определения того, какие рекламные инструменты будут работать на их страницах в том случае, если блокировщик активирован на устройстве пользователя.
Существует несколько способов проверки наличия блокировщика рекламы. Один из них - использование библиотеки AdBlock Detection, которая позволяет определить, активирован ли блокировщик на устройстве пользователя.
Для этого необходимо подключить библиотеку в свой код на странице и использовать ее API. Например, можно добавить следующий код на странице:
Этот код будет проверять, активирован ли блокировщик и выводить в консоль соответствующее сообщение.
Другой способ проверки - использование фильтров, которые блокируют определенные рекламные элементы. Например, если на сайте используется Google AdSense, можно проверить наличие блокировщика, попытавшись загрузить изображение с URL-адресом, содержащим слово "ads". Если изображение не будет загружено, то блокировщик активирован.
var img = new Image();
img.onload = function() {
console.log('Блокировщик не активирован');
};
img.onerror = function() {
console.log('Блокировщик активирован');
};
img.src = 'http://pagead2.googlesyndication.com/pagead/imgad?id=CICAgKDT9PSyjxgwAhjgATIAAAFvjgHj-gw.jpg';
Этот код попытается загрузить изображение, которое содержит слово "ads", и в зависимости от результата загрузки выведет соответствующее сообщение в консоль.
В целом, проверка наличия блокировщика рекламы может быть полезной, если вам нужно определить, какие рекламные инструменты будут работать на вашем сайте или в приложении, если у пользователя активирован блокировщик.